Bottom left table one minute in. SB minraises your blind making it $1 to go, you repop him to $7. There is no reason to bet so much. Your standard 3-bet is to $7 you say. Well, the standard opening is $2. In that case, $7 seems like a decent amount. Here villain is likely on a steal given the size of the raise and your read that he is raising a lot. The only time your big bet will make a difference is when villain has a real hand.
